The Medilap 400 Matrix+ is a 400-watt, high-power electrosurgical generator designed for the modern operating room and advanced training environments. This unit is built for precision and safety. It incorporates a smart tissue impedance monitoring system that continuously measures the electrical resistance of the tissue. Based on these readings, the generator automatically adjusts its power output. This feature ensures consistent performance across various tissue types without needing constant manual adjustments. | Feature | Specification |
|---|---|
| Product dimensions | 390 x 130 x 340 mm (L x H x W) |
| Product weight | 6.5 Kg |
| Applicable education levels | Higher education, vocational training, medical schools |
| Model | 400 Matrix+ |
| Input voltage | 200-220V AC / 50 Hz |
| Current fuse | 6 Amps |
| Nominal frequency | 350 kHz |
| High frequency | <150μA RMS in all |
| Low frequency | <10μA max |
| Power activation | Two independent monopolar (hand/foot), one bipolar (foot) |
| Safety feature 1 | Tissue impedance sensing technology |
| Safety feature 2 | Patient plate fault monitoring system |
| Safety feature 3 | Auto-monitoring with error indicators |
| Performance feature 1 | Self-adjustment of power output |
| Performance feature 2 | Minimized RF distortion |
| Display | Digital display of power and modes |

It is a feature that measures the resistance of the target tissue to the electrical current. The Medilap 400 Matrix+ uses this data to automatically adjust its power output, ensuring consistent performance and preventing unnecessary tissue damage by delivering a precise amount of energy.
The machine includes a patient plate fault monitoring system to ensure the return electrode is properly connected, which helps prevent potential burns. It also has an auto-monitoring facility that indicates different errors with alarms and visual indicators if any issue arises during use.
